Interpersonal Conflict: an existential-phenomenological perspective

 

Karen Weixel-Dixon takes an existential-phenomenologically-informed view of conflict. She posits that conflict of any kind is always personal and that facilitating conflict resolution has little to do with objective logic or rationale and everything to do with personal (and cultural) values and aspirations. 

Karen will examine with you the root of conflict and explore the significant role of emotions and the ‘why’ and ‘how’ of resolution in order to deepen understanding of the defensive strategies that almost always come into play. The aim is for you to gain a better understanding of how to engage with the conflict resolution process so that a fruitful outcome emerges.
